textscan for string with white spaces

I use textscan to read in data from a file with the format as follows:
1790 2700 red blue white
2783 3185
4835 4849
4854 4865 blue white
fid = fopen(filename);
data = textscan(fid, '%d%d%s');
fclose(fid);
And would like my variable data consists of 3 cells, the first two cells that are integers and the last cell contains empty string or string with white spaces. I failed to produce the output after many attempts. Is there a better way to do that? Thanks.
